RE05 LDX is a 2005 BMW F Series in Black with a 652c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 18 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 77.8%.

Across all 2005 BMW F Series models, the average MOT pass rate is 86.6% with a typical mileage of 17,135 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.

The most common reason a BMW F Series fails its MOT is shock absorber seal failed and leaking oil, accounting for 651 recorded failures. If you're considering buying RE05 LDX,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.

The BMW F Series typically stays on UK roads for around 26 years. At 21 years old, this BMW F Series is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
